Adarsh Dant Sudha Herbal Tooth Powder is a natural oral care formula made with traditional Ayurvedic ingredients. It is designed to support daily oral hygiene by helping in gentle teeth cleansing, maintaining freshness, and promoting overall mouth cleanliness. The blend includes Trikatu (ginger, black pepper, long pepper), Triphala (amla, haritaki, bibhitaki), Saindhava Namak (rock salt), and natural tooth-powder components that work together to provide a clean and refreshed oral experience. Suitable for everyday use and for people who prefer herbal oral care.

Adarsh Dant Sudha Manjan is a dental powder that is claimed to help with dental pain, effective teeth cleansing, and prevention of bad odors in the mouth. The mentioned components of the powder include:
1. Trikatu: Trikatu is a combination of three herbs – ginger (zingiber officinale), black pepper (piper nigrum), and long pepper (piper longum). It is known for its digestive and oral health benefits.
2. Triphala: Triphala is a herbal formula comprising three fruits – amla (Emblica officinalis), haritaki (Terminalia chebula), and bibhitaki (Terminalia bellirica). It is commonly used in Ayurveda for its cleansing and rejuvenating properties.
3. Tooth Powder: This refers to various ingredients used in dental powders, such as natural abrasives (like rock salt or sea salt) that help in cleaning the teeth and maintaining oral hygiene.
4. Saindhava Namak: Saindhava namak, also known as rock salt, is a type of mineral salt often used in Ayurvedic preparations. It is believed to have several health benefits, including improving oral health.
5. Samundar Namak: Samundar namak, or sea salt, is another type of salt that may be included in the formulation. It is known for its antibacterial properties and its potential role in maintaining oral hygiene.
6. TUTH OPPERSUPHATE;- Copper sulfate, also known as cupric sulfate or copper(II) sulfate, is a chemical compound with the formula CuSO4. It is a blue crystalline solid and is commonly used in various industries and applications, including agriculture, chemistry, and even as a pesticide.
In dentistry, copper sulfate is sometimes used as an ingredient in certain dental products or formulations. It may have antimicrobial properties and can be used in dental irrigation solutions or as an ingredient in root canal sealers.

Guggul is an Ayurvedic herbal medicine that is commonly used in the treatment of various ailments, particularly those related to the respiratory and digestive systems. It is made from a combination of several herbs, including Kachnar (Bauhinia variegata) and Guggul (Commiphora mukul).
According to Ayurveda, Kachnar Guggul is particularly effective in treating conditions such as bronchitis, asthma, and cough due to its anti-inflammatory and expectorant properties. It is also used to treat digestive disorders such as bloating, constipation, and indigestion.
Kachnar Guggul is available in tablet form and is usually taken with warm water or milk. The recommended dosage may vary depending on the individual’s condition and overall health, and it is important to consult with a qualified Ayurvedic practitioner before taking this medicine.
It is important to note that Kachnar Guggul may cause side effects such as stomach upset, diarrhea, and allergic reactions in some individuals. Pregnant and breastfeeding women should also avoid taking Kachnar Guggul without consulting with a healthcare provider.

Triphala Ghan is an Ayurvedic medicine made from the extract of three fruits – Amla (Emblica officinalis), Haritaki (Terminalia chebula), and Bibhitaki (Terminalia bellirica). The combination of these three fruits is believed to have a synergistic effect and offer a wide range of potential health benefits.Triphala Ghan is available in capsule or tablet form and should be taken under the guidance of a qualified healthcare professional. It may interact with certain medications or have potential side effects, especially in individuals with pre-existing medical conditions.
Triphala Ghan is commonly used to support digestive health, as it is believed to help regulate bowel movements, promote healthy digestion, and relieve constipation. It is also believed to have antioxidant properties, which may help protect against cellular damage caused by free radicals.
